    In this powerful episode, Dr. Lynn Hellerstein of Vision Beyond Sight sits down with Mardi Moore, CEO of Rocky Mountain Equality and the Rocky Mountain Equality Action Fund, for a candid conversation about advancing the rights, visibility, and socio-economic well-being of the LGBTQ+ community. Together, they explore the current wave of anti-trans legislation and executive actions, and the real-world consequences of policy decisions affecting gender-affirming care through Medicare, Medicaid, and CHIP. Mardi shares heartbreaking and inspiring stories — from partners denied hospital access before marriage equality to bullied LGBTQ+ youth finding safety and belonging through community support. The conversation highlights the wide-ranging work of Rocky Mountain Equality: protecting trans youth, training law enforcement through the Safety in Pride program, supporting people who relocate to Colorado for affirming care, convening faith leaders for mutual aid efforts, condensing complex federal reports into accessible information, and advocating for fair-minded candidates in schools and public office. Grounded in resilience and Harvey Milk’s quote “You got to give them hope,” this episode is both a clear-eyed look at today’s challenges and an uplifting reminder that change happens through community, courage, and love.     Dr. Lynn Hellerstein of Vision Beyond Sight speaks with Patricia Lemer, co-founder of Developmental Delay Resources, licensed professional counselor, educational diagnostician, author, podcast host and well-known for her Total Load Theory of autism. Patty talks about her 4th book entitled Total Load Theory: Transforming Lives in Autism, ADHD, LD and Mental Health, and provides insight on how our lifestyle issues, unresolved traumas, visual dysfunction, food sensitivities (like gluten) and other factors in our everyday living (like mold) affect autism, learning disorders and mental health. All the load adds up until our body breaks down. Learn about the Everyday Epigenetics Evaluator that shows how our environment tweaks our genes, and how metabolic psychiatry and functional medicine can help where talk therapy and medication cannot. Find out about the dysregulated nervous system and how not feeling safe can be an impediment to healing, then learn simple biohacking techniques to regu-late your vagus nerve, like gargling.     Dr. Lynn Hellerstein of Vision Beyond Sight speaks with Dr. Katherine Reid, founder of Unblind My Mind, and author, to talk about glutamate hidden in the food supply wreaking havoc on our health. With a daughter in the autism spectrum, Katherine discovered that removing gluten (including MSG) and casein in her food led to positive changes in her daughter’s behavior, language and creativity. She then applied her expertise in biochemistry to study increased glutamate signaling in the body and its connection to chronic inflammations, one of the body’s ways of signaling red fire alert. Learn about Katherine’s struggles for glutamate awareness: against the quality of food available in schools, manufacturers that are not required to disclose glutamate content, the medical community’s shortcomings, and indeed even her daughter who upon her adulthood decided to go back to eating highly processed food (with negative results, as Katherine observed). Find out about the importance of fiber, tips on choosing organic food, and how to quality control your home’s food as detailed in her book, Fat, Stressed and Sick: MSG, Processed Foods and America’s Health Crisis.     Dr. Lynn Hellerstein of Vision Beyond Sight speaks with Lisa Skinner, behavioral specialist, certified dementia practitioner, certified dementia care trainer, certified program director, 4x bestselling author, TED Speaker, and internationally recognized podcast host (ranked top 10% globally), to talk about why we should all be concerned about Alzheimer’s disease and related dementia. Do you know that it is projected that people who will develop Alzheimer’s in the next 25 years around the world will triple? Are you aware that people can also be living with more than one brain disease at the same time? Find out the risk factors that contribute to Alzheimer’s and dementia, and realize that ultimately, there is hope! Lisa gives a rundown of modifiable risk factors in lifestyle like sleep quality, diet and exercise, and conditions like cardiovascular diseases, diabetes, hearing loss and isolation. Everything is intermingled! Discover how to stimulate your brain and produce neuroplasticity as protection. Even a regular brisk walk can make a huge difference! If you’re living with a patient, it’s important to understand all the symptoms and behaviors like hallucinations, wandering and severe mood changes, and to learn how to respond to them effectively.
